Overview
Dioseve is developing ReproNest (development code DIOS-101), a co-culture IVM product that uses ovarian support cell-like cells differentiated from iPS cells to support maturation of immature oocytes. The co-culture approach cultivates patient-derived oocytes together with support cells in the same system and is not intended as a cell therapy for administration into the body. Non-clinical studies reported by the company have shown potential benefits in supporting oocyte maturation compared with conventional IVM culture conditions. The company's technological strength is its proprietary differentiation induction technology, which it says enables efficient induction of oocytes and ovarian somatic cells from iPS cells and production of ovarian support cell-like cells. Dioseve sees applications in fertility preservation (including oocyte freezing), treatment of patients at high risk of OHSS, and rapid fertility preservation before cancer treatment. The recent funding will support validation, manufacturing and quality control setup, reproducibility assessment, regulatory compliance work, and business development to advance ReproNest toward practical application.
